Frequently Asked Questions
How often should I clean my diffuser?
It's best to clean your diffuser every 1-2 weeks, especially if you notice the mist weakening or unusual odors. Use a mixture of water and white vinegar to descale and prevent mineral build-up.
Is ultrasonic technology safe and eco-friendly?
Yes, ultrasonic diffusers use water and ultrasonic vibrations to disperse essential oils as fine mist, avoiding heat or chemicals. They are energy-efficient and do not produce harmful emissions.
Can I use any essential oils with these diffusers?
Most are compatible with pure essential oils; however, check the manufacturer's guidelines to ensure no damage occurs. Avoid using synthetic fragrance oils, which are less eco-friendly and may clog your diffuser.
